Output 425eb746efb8840063e85a4a2c8cd6df2497d02fcab79f40f49084a62a8546e4:5

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3075d55e234fd5eea8e49e97d23af2a05361fd63 OP_EQUALVERIFY OP_CHECKSIG
address
15REbRQKiBfU6HHqbtU62GD35cPLEckbNY
transaction
425eb746efb8840063e85a4a2c8cd6df2497d02fcab79f40f49084a62a8546e4
confirmations
548229
spent
true